The Department of Bioengineering in the College of Engineering at the University of Texas at Arlington invites applications for a Post-Doctoral Research Associate. We are seeking a highly motivated postdoctoral candidate with experience in cancer research and strong analytical skills. The Lal Lab develops computational and systems biology approaches to understand treatment response, toxicity, and disease progression in cancer. Our research integrates multi-omic sequencing, network biology, and machine learning to identify actionable biomarkers and therapeutic vulnerabilities.The successful candidate will work at the interface of computational genomics, AI-driven modeling, and translational oncology, analyzing large-scale multi-omic datasets from pediatric cancer cohorts.
